<p>The son of former NFL quarterback Archie Manning and the elder brother of New York Giants quarterback Eli Manning, Peyton Manning is an American football player in the national Football League. Peyton spent most of his career playing for Indianapolis Colts and switched to Denver Broncos after the injury in 2012. Manning’s exclusive playing manner has earned him a nickname “<i>The Sheriff</i>”.</p>
<h2><b>Money and Career</b></h2>
<p>Peyton Manning’s net worth is currently estimated at $115 million and his annual earnings as for the year 2012-2013 were $43 million.<br />
Peyton Manning is one of the highest paid athletes in the world both on and off the field. As a member of the Denver Broncos, Peyton commands $18 million per year in base salary. He also has the ability to earn millions more in bonuses and incentives.<br />
Outside of sports, Peyton earns an additional $25 million per year from endorsements, bringing his total annual income to $43 million.He endorses many major brands and frequently appears in television commercials for brands like Buick, Papa John’s and DirecTV. He has extremely lucrative endorsement deals with a wide range of companies including Sony, ESPN, Spring, DirecTV, Master Card, Reebok and Gatorade. Peyton also owns twenty one Papa John&#8217;s pizza franchises located in Colorado. He also made his entertainment-world debut as the host of an episode of Saturday Night Live in 2007.<br />
Shortly after beginning his NFL career, Manning founded his charity the Peyback Foundation, whose mission is to help disadvantaged kids.</p>
<p>Manning has an excellent memory for plays and memorized the Colts&#8217; playbook within a week after being drafted, and in 2012 was able to precisely recall the details and timing of a specific play he had used at Tennessee 16 years earlier.<br />
As an author, he has co-authored with his father, Archie and brother, Eli titled: “Manning: A Father, His Sons, and a Football Legacy” released in 2000. In 2009, he again co-authored children’s book with Eli and Archie entitled: Family Huddle, which describes in simple text and pictures how the three Manning brothers played football as young boys. He has donated over $8,000 to Republican politicians, among them Fred Thompson, Bob Corker, and former President George W. Bush.</p>

<h2><b>Early life</b></h2>
<p>Born in a family of a great athlete Archie Manning, a former American football quarterback, who has played for New Orleans Saints for nearly ten years, it seems like Peyton inherited the skills in his blood. Peyton was great at the game since the day he started playing. Already back at high school he has led his team to numerous victories and won various accolades. After graduation Peyton chose to play for the team of University of Tennessee. During the years at university Peyton played 45 games and won 39 of them. Peyton received an invitation to play at the National Football League for Indianapolis Colts right after he graduated from Tennessee.</p>
<p>To date, Peyton is the NFL record holder for most consecutive seasons with over 4,000 yards passing and most total seasons with 4,000 or more yards passing in a career. Peyton lead the Colts to a Super Bowl victory in 2006 against the Chicago Bears. Over his career, Peyton has received dozens of accolades including being a 13 time Pro-Bowl selection and four-time AP NFL MVP.</p>
<p>Unfortunately, Peyton was injured before the start of the 2011 season and was not able to play in a single game. After months of rumors, on March 7th 2012, Peyton Manning was let go by the Indianapolis Colts which made him a free agent to seek new offers. He soon signed a new $96 million contract with The Denver Broncos.</p>

<p>Former American quarterback, who has registered dozens of National Football League records in his account regarding his quarterback position, Daniel Constantine ‘Dan’ Marino Jr. have also credited $35 million in his net worth. Played for Miami Dolphins of the National Football League, Dan Marino is the synonym for the greatest quarterbacks in the history of American football. 2005 saw his entry into the Hall of Fame.<br />
<strong> From College Football to National Football</strong><br />
With his roots laid in Italian and Polish culture, Marino was born in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ania and brought up in South Oakland. Dan Marino is the eldest child of Daniel and Veronica Marino, and has two sisters, Cindi and Debbie.<br />
He started his career in baseball when he was studying in Central Catholic High School in Pittsburgh, and eventually shifted his focus towards football when he won All American honor in football from American nationwide Sunday Newspaper ‘Parade’. 1979 paved way to his fortune by Kansas City Royals signing him as an amateur for their football team, but instead Marino selected to be with college team. Marino played football on behalf of his college, University of Pittsburgh’s, whose team was also known as ‘Pitt Panthers’. Starting as a freshman, Marino led his team to coup over West Virginia and Penn State in 1979 and last minute triumph over Georgia Bulldog in 1982. Consecutively during the three seasons that took place from 1979 to 1981, Marino made sure that he was in the top 5 rankings of media poll.<br />
Marino’s senior year saw his tumbling football career as well as Pitt team’s bad fate. This even led to a halt in Marino’s selection in 1983 National Football League regarding his downgraded performance in the senior years as well as widespread rumours of his drug use. In Miami Dolphin’s list Marino was the 27th pick in the first round.<br />
In the history of the United States Football League, Marino was the first draft pick selected by Los Angeles Express. Again, he decided to go with Dolphins instead of signing Los Angeles Express. He was given a start in 6th week against the Buffalo Bills. Both Miami and Marino lost the game, but this loss turned out to be victory for both Marino and his team because of the various records that Marino had afforded in the season. Second season saw Marino breaking many records and made him the ‘Most Valuable player’ in the National Football League. Marino’s only Super Bowl appearance was in Super Bowl XIX, where Miami Dolphin’s confronted San Francisco 49ers and Joe Montana in Palo Alto, California and lost the game by 38-16.<br />
In 1993, Miami Dolphins tried for a comeback in American Football Conference Championship and thought of making it to Super Bowl series, but with Marino’s small vacation with the game, he fell down hurting his Achilles tendon during the play and was out for the season. Soon in 1994, Marino again showed up in the season as starting quarterback, with a special shoe on one foot and having an atrophied right calf.<br />

In 1992, Marino and his wife Claire, established a foundation for people with autism, called Dan Marino Foundation; after their own son Michael was diagnosed with autism. They have also opened a integrated neurodevelopment center, Dan Marino Center, alongside Miami Children’s Hospital, where children with developmental risk and psychological problems are diagnosed and treated. On March 23, 2010, The Dan Marino Foundation held its first &#8220;Walk about Autism&#8221;. Over 6000 walkers participated, as well as 420 volunteers provided by the Miami Dolphins Special Teams.<br />
<strong>Net worth</strong><br />
Marino owns vacation homes in Kiawah Island, South Carolina. He also owns two restaurants in Miami and Las Vegas (Dan Marino’s Fine Food and Spirits). Marino is a partner/investor in a Florida-based restaurant group named Anthony’s Coal Fired Pizza. Marino had investments in MMD Realty, a real estate company. Marino earned more than $1 million a year from endorsements for AutoNation (the car dealership chain) as well as Nabisco (a subsidiary of Kraft Foods). By the time he retired, he was earning a handsome amount of around $6 million a year.</p>

<p>Roger Goodell is the Commissioner of National Football League who has a net worth of about $75 million. He has obtained this position after the successfully winning the competition over four finalists. He was selected for the president of NFL charities and this duty comes along as a substitution with the Commissioner’s job. Commentators in NFL season 2006 entitled him as ‘the most powerful man in sports’ all over the country.</p>
<p><b>Star of the season:</b></p>
<p>Goodell took birth in Jamestown, New York on February 19<sup>th</sup>, 1959.  He was born to Senator Charles Ellsworth Goodell and Jean Goodell. He had completed his schooling from Bronxville High School. During his graduation, he became the star of basketball, baseball and football too. He also got the opportunity to serve all the three teams as a captain and was entitled as the athlete of the year in school. He had completed his graduation in 1981 from Washington &amp; Jefferson College in Pennsylvania with a master in economics.  Due to various injuries he got in high school, he was unable to play football.</p>
<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/2014/03/roger3.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7294" alt="roger3" src="/wp-content/uploads/2014/03/roger3.jpg" width="300" height="168" /></a></p>
<p><b>Journey from Intern to COO:</b></p>
<p>Goodell stars started to shine in 1982 when he was chosen as the administrative intern of NFL in New York. He was working under Pete Rozelle, commissioner of NFL during those days. In 1983 he moved to New York Jets for the internship, but again took a transition and moved as an assistant in the publicity department in the league office in 1984. In 1987, he was selected for the position of President of the American Football Conference. Under the reign of Pete Rozelle, he was appointed for NFL Executive Vice President and then Chief Operating Officer in 2001. Being the NFL’s COO, he got the responsibility for various operations in Football league as well as became the supervisor of league’s business functions. He also became the head of NFL ventures which had to manage all the functions of marketing and sales department, stadium development and media properties too.</p>
<p>Goodell involved himself in the Collective bargaining agreement between the NFLPA and NFL owners in 2011. He also played a lead role in the expansion and realignment of league, development of the stadium. He also secured new agreements on television and launched NFL Network.</p>
<p><b>Tough Competition for Commissioner:</b></p>
<p>Goodell was selected as a commissioner after the retirement of Paul Tagliabue. Paul formed a committee owned by Dan Rooney, who belonged to the Pittsburgh Steelers for the search of his successor. Goodell was in the list of five finalists, including Robert Reynolds, Mayo Shattuck III, Gregg Levy and Frederick Nance. In the first ballot, he was ahead of Levy but in the second and third ballot Goodell made a lead with 17-14 and in the fourth it made a score of 21-10. In the fifth ballot two owners swung their votes. And finally he was selected as the commissioner of the NFL in 2006 after Paul Tagliabue. His main duty being the commissioner of the NFL is to maintain the integrity of the game and protect the shield.</p>

<p><b>New policies launched by him:</b></p>
<p>In 2007, NFL Personal Conduct Policy came into existence after the scandal of NFL players off the field. Chris Henry and Pacman Jones were the two players who were suspended due to this new policy. A month later Tank Johnson was suspended due to weapon association and drunk driving. Goodell also suspended Dallas Cowboys and fined him $100,000. Rodney Harrison also captured due to the illegal of banned medical products. He also started a policy in which no misbehavior will be accepted in the field. He started charging fine for that and various players became a victim of this like James Harrison, Dunta Robinson etc. He emphasizes more on the safe techniques to play the game. This attitude was criticized by various players and they felt that he was making wrong use of his power and trying to impose his decision over them. In 2007, he became a danger for New England Patriots after the illegal work done them of making a video tape of the signals. He firstly decided to suspend Bill Belichick, but then he thought charging fine of $250,000 would be more effective than the suspension.</p>
<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/2014/03/roger1.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7292" alt="roger1" src="/wp-content/uploads/2014/03/roger1.jpg" width="259" height="194" /></a></p>
<p><b>Earned money by charging fine:</b></p>
<p>In 2012, Goodell came across New Orleans Saints in which Saints players were paid bonuses after knocking opposite players out of the game. He launched a bounty program in which he put harsh penalties on the Saint defensive players. He also suspended Williams and he would not be able to apply again till 2012 end. Saints were charged with a fine of about $ 500,000 and stripped out of 2012 and 2013 draft picks.</p>

<p>Jerry rice is a famous name in the football world. He is a retired American sportsperson who played in the National Football League for twenty seasons as a wide receiver in the football world. He has made his name as one of the richest and most successful NFL player in the history of the football world. In the year 2010 he was chosen as the greatest player in the National League Football history in the list of “The Top 100: NFL’s Greatest Players”. He has been on the top position in the touchdown receptions, yards and receptions. He is that one NFL player who is missed in the football field. Rice has played for many successful NFL teams which include Seattle Seahawks, Oakland Raiders, Denver Broncos and San Francisco 49ers. In the year 2006 he took a retirement from a glorious career of 20 years in the NFL field.</p>
<p>EARLY LIFE AND THE MAKING OF THE FOOTBALL STAR</p>
<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/2014/03/JERRY-RICE-CAREER.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-8707" alt="JERRY RICE CAREER" src="/wp-content/uploads/2014/03/JERRY-RICE-CAREER.jpg" width="283" height="178" /></a></p>
<p>Jerry gave birth in Crawford in Mississippi on 13 October in the year 1962. Jerry didn’t see a luxurious childhood. His father was a brick mason and according to Jerry it is through working with his father as a mason he has developed the strength and the hands required by a football player. He was interested in football since his childhood days and was an ace player in the high school. He went to Mississippi Valley State University from the year 1981 to 1984. He got his name “world” during his college days and he was so called as there was not a single ball in the whole world, Jerry missed to catch. He has made many records which include NCAA marks for 1,450 receiving yards and 102 receptions. In the year 1999, his school changed the name of their football stadium to Rice- Totten Stadium from Magnolia Stadium to honor their two ace players Rice and Totten.</p>
